查看: 791|回复: 7
|
asp.net SQLSErver Login Failed for CALVIN\ASPNET
[复制链接]
|
|
这个问题我之前问过,也解决了。
之前是因为没有加CALVIN\ASPNET 的user, 我加了后就可以了。。
不过现在不同的是。我用VS2005 compile 的时候, access 进 sql server 2000 完全没有问题。。
可是当我开browser type "http://localhost/xxxx/Login.aspx " 时。。当有access database 的时候,
就出现这个问题了 -> "Login failed for CALVIN\ASPNET"
我确定的去add 过CALVIN\ASPNEt 这个 user, 可是却说 user is existed 了。。。所以到底是什么问题了?? |
|
|
|
|
|
|
|
发表于 28-9-2006 03:48 PM
|
显示全部楼层
假如你直接在 VS2005 COMPILE 来 RUN 你的 PROJECT 和 CONNECT SQL2005, 不要在 browser type "http://localhost/xxxx/Login.aspx ", 会有问题吗? |
|
|
|
|
|
|
|
楼主 |
发表于 28-9-2006 04:52 PM
|
显示全部楼层
原帖由 Chrysan 于 28-9-2006 03:48 PM 发表
假如你直接在 VS2005 COMPILE 来 RUN 你的 PROJECT 和 CONNECT SQL2005, 不要在 browser type "http://localhost/xxxx/Login.aspx ", 会有问题吗?
我没有用sql server 2005 ..我的是express 来的、 我去configuration manager 那边start liao sql server browser 和 services 后,不知怎样browse database, 因为express 的没有 Exterprice manager.. 我不会用咧。。
所以现在我的是VS2005 + MSSQL 2000 ..
假如直接由VS2005 compile 的话。。是全都没有问题。。。。
就是说可以access 到database 咯。。
。。。。不知是不是vs2005 的问题?
我之前用VS2003 是可以直接在browser 开的。。那时候也是在用MSSQL 2000.. |
|
|
|
|
|
|
|
发表于 29-9-2006 02:09 PM
|
显示全部楼层
那是因为 user CALVIN\ASPNET has no right to access your sql2005 database, 你要 assign database access right 给 user CALVIN\ASPNET.
我也是用 express version, 你可以用 SQL Server Management Studio Express 来 assign right, express version 是没有 Enterprise Manager 的. |
|
|
|
|
|
|
|
楼主 |
发表于 29-9-2006 02:29 PM
|
显示全部楼层
原帖由 Chrysan 于 29-9-2006 02:09 PM 发表
那是因为 user CALVIN\ASPNET has no right to access your sql2005 database, 你要 assign database access right 给 user CALVIN\ASPNET.
我也是用 express version, 你可以用 SQL Server Management Studio ...
我没用sql2005, 我已经uninstall 了。。一直我都是用2000 的,,
for CALVIN\ASPNET ..我develop 之前就已经assign right 给每一个Database le1.... |
|
|
|
|
|
|
|
发表于 29-9-2006 03:11 PM
|
显示全部楼层
噢... 是我搞错吗?
我也遇到你说的问题, 我是用像我说的那样来解决的. |
|
|
|
|
|
|
|
楼主 |
发表于 29-9-2006 04:11 PM
|
显示全部楼层
原帖由 Chrysan 于 29-9-2006 03:11 PM 发表
噢... 是我搞错吗?
我也遇到你说的问题, 我是用像我说的那样来解决的.
现在可以了。。可能会是SQL server 2005 和 2000 之间有crash 到还是conflict 吧,之前有出现过什么什么 SQL server 20005 的 error msg 的, 可是我都没有configure 过。。所以我把全部uninstall 再install 过 咯。。 重新add 过 CALVIN|ASPNET 咯。。无论如何。。谢谢你。。。 |
|
|
|
|
|
|
|
发表于 29-9-2006 04:43 PM
|
显示全部楼层
原帖由 zuying1985 于 29-9-2006 04:11 PM 发表
现在可以了。。可能会是SQL server 2005 和 2000 之间有crash 到还是conflict 吧,之前有出现过什么什么 SQL server 20005 的 error msg 的, 可是我都没有configure 过。。所以我把全部uninstall 再instal ...
不客气叻... 都没帮到你... |
|
|
|
|
|
|
| |
本周最热论坛帖子
|